It's hard! I did mini workouts, like ten minutes of body weight exercises any time I was waiting for something. I was always in labs, and stood up and moved around instead of sitting. Also, I took advantage of the PE resources on campus, like a rec center, which was open to students, and the dance classes. Even though I didn't work out every day, if I don't exercise almost every day, I don't sleep as well, feel as well, or think as well.0

Do you have access to your school gym? When I was a student I would work out before or right after a class depending on my schedule for the day. I often prefered to get up go to the gym and the shower and straight into class. You only really need 30 mins or so and alternate your strength days and your cardio days. You don't have to spend more than an hour in the gym if you don't have time. Or download short workout videos from online. 10 min here and there, good for the stress of study as well.0
